Abstract

L'invention se situe dans le domaine du démarrage et du redémarrage d'un moteur à combustion interne. Elle concerne un procédé de commande d'un démarreur pour un moteur à combustion interne et un dispositif de protection d'une couronne dentée du moteur à combustion interne et d'un pignon du démarreur. Selon l'invention, l'engagement du pignon dans la couronne dentée est empêché pendant une durée déterminée à compter de la fin du précédent démarrage, la durée étant déterminée en fonction, d'une part, d'une vitesse de rotation du démarreur estimée à la fin du précédent démarrage et, d'autre part, d'un modèle (21, 22) donnant une estimation d'une durée d'arrêt du démarreur en fonction de sa vitesse de rotation à la fin d'un démarrage. La vitesse de rotation du démarreur est estimée comme étant égale soit à la vitesse de rotation à vide du démarreur dans le cas où la roue libre du démarreur est enclenchée, soit à la vitesse de rotation du moteur à combustion interne.
